Well, it’s Wednesday and I still have not come up with a hip name for my Writing Prompt Wednesday, so guess what we are going to call it. That’s right! Writing Prompt Wednesday.
Here’s how it’s going to work. Each Wednesday throughout the summer, I will post some sort of writing prompt on this blog. It might be a picture, a word or phrase, or a bit of dialogue. It could even be a feeling or a smell.
Anyone who wishes to play along may write a scene or an entire story using the prompt. You can keep these stories to yourself if you like, using this as an exercise for your writing brain, or you may share with us in the comments below. Occasionally I will share my scene or story as well.
If you choose to share your story in the comments, please keep it clean. I started this series by request of a student, and would like to keep it where people of all ages and backgrounds can participate.
There are no winners and losers here, no prizes or fame to be had. My intent is for everyone who participates to have fun and be encouraged.
Here is the writing prompt for this week.
You open the door to your backyard and see this. How did it get there? Where did it come from? What are you going to do about it? (These are just some questions to get you thinking...answer one, all or none.) Have fun.
